How do you graph a picture on Desmos?

To add an image to your graph, start by opening the Add Item menu and choose Image. Clicking and dragging the image into the expression list is also supported in many browsers. To Move the image, click on the center point and drag the image to where you’d like to place it.

How do you draw a circle on a graph?

Graphing a circle anywhere on the coordinate plane is pretty easy when its equation appears in center-radius form. All you do is plot the center of the circle at (h, k), and then count out from the center r units in the four directions (up, down, left, right). Then, connect those four points with a nice, round circle.

What is Desmos art?

This desmos art takes on many forms: from geometric patterns to architectural scenes, to renderings of famous paintings, to self-portraits and beyond.The one thing these graphs all have in common is that they are made entirely of graphed mathematical expressions.

How do I make a line graph?

To draw a line graph, first draw a horizontal and a vertical axis. Age should be plotted on the horizontal axis because it is independent. Height should be plotted on the vertical axis. Then look for the given data and plot a point for each pair of values.

How do you fill out a circle graph?

To complete the circle graph, you must find exactly what fraction or percent each item represents. The easiest way to do this is to take the quotient of the part and the whole and then convert the result to a percent. The percent that each item represents was given in the table above.

How do I make a graph on my desktop?

Here’s how to draw a line graph:

  1. Select the data, including the labels.
  2. From the ‘Insert’ menu, pick ‘Chart . . .’.
  3. In the dialogue box that appears, click on ‘Line Graph’.
  4. Click ‘OK’ or ‘Finish’. You should now have a lovely line graph.
